Professor Glenn King is a NHMRC Leadership Fellow and Group Leader at the Institute for Molecular Bioscience, University of Queensland. He holds an Affiliate Professor position in the School of Chemistry and Molecular Biosciences. His research focuses on harnessing venom peptides from arthropods to develop drugs for neurological disorders (e.g., chronic pain, epilepsy, stroke) and environmentally friendly insecticides. He has authored over 400 publications and leads a multidisciplinary team of researchers and students.
Education: BSc (University of Sydney), PhD (University of Sydney).
Research interests span venom-based drug discovery, ion channel modulation, and pest control solutions. Key achievements include developing Hi1a, a stroke neuroprotective agent, and identifying novel insecticidal peptides. His work bridges basic science and translational medicine, with active collaborations in drug development and toxicology.
Current grants include NHMRC Investigator Grants for venom-to-drug translation and MRFF funding for cardiovascular therapies. He supervises multiple PhD students and has mentored over 50 researchers. His lab is part of the ARC Centre of Excellence for Innovations in Peptide and Protein Science.
Scientific awards: NHMRC Leadership Fellow (2021–2028). His research also involves structural studies of venom peptides and their mechanisms of action, with applications in imaging and diagnostics.
